LOT 1511

Old Babylonian Carnelian Frog Amulet on Gold Ring

20TH-16TH CENTURY B.C.

1 1/8 in. (2.45 grams, 29.30 mm).

The frog modelled in the round, pierced at the middle and mounted on a later asymmetrical gold hoop.

Provenance

Ex K.J. collection.
Acquired on the North American art market, 1999.
European private collection.
